The first concerns the American dollar, although it’s gained in strength right now. I’m not an advisor so I would never tell you to do anything around this, but I have an opinion.

Many people’s opinion is that fundamentally, the US economy is poor. Therefore, the dollar will be weak and will continue to go down. What do you do? You need to get some, not all, of your money and consider the possibility of diversifying. Take some of your money and invest it outside the US.

What does this do? That means that should the dollar go down, which a lot of experts believe it will, if you have a 5% return on your investment outside of the US and the dollar goes down 10%, in essence you have a 15% return on your money in whatever you have outside of the country.

Real estate investments outside of the US seem to be stronger than in the US right now, places like the Dominican Republic, Costa Rica and all over the Caribbean. I’m not saying they’re great shakes based on the economy, but they certainly seem to be holding their own, if not better, and are still going up in a lot of places.

There are a lot of opportunities for you to consider real estate outside of North America, and the US especially. Even Canada - although Alberta has come down a little bit to come back to reality. As oil still is king, chances are that Alberta will continue to do really well.

A lot of you are losing right now. You’re selling things at a loss. Whether it is real estate, stocks or anything of the sort, if someone sells something at a loss, the operative word is “selling.” That means there are two people in that transaction. There’s a seller and there’s a buyer.

If someone is selling at a loss, the buyer must be buying at a very good price. They’re buying a win. Somebody is losing and somebody is winning. Hopefully it doesn’t pan out just like that. In general, when people are losing money, there are opportunities to take the other side of that. Somebody has to buy that at a loss.

If I bought something at $50 and am selling it now at $30, someone is buying it at $30. That person has the gold, basically. That’s a critical thing. On the other side of every transaction is another purchaser. Someone is calling this garbage and getting rid of it. The other person is thinking, “Wow, this is gold! I’m going to take it.”

Harv: Let’s talk about business in general. First of all, this is a great time to get better at what you do, to get better at business, get more knowledge, and set your business up in such a way that it’s literally fail proof.

You need to go on a business diet. You have to tighten up your belt. You have to become lean, mean and--here’s my key word--nimble. You have to be flexible. You have to be able not only to survive, but also to do decently at lower revenue if that’s the way it is. I’m not saying that it’s going to be that. You want to stay positive, increase your sales, etc. If worse comes to worst, if it’s going to be chopped down by 40%, then your expenses must be chopped by 40%. There is nothing that is more important than that.

Expenses can kill you. Overhead can kill you. It can destroy. It does destroy almost every business that doesn’t make it. You have to take whatever in your business, and you have to go to need, need, need. There’s no more want.

In a diet, you would eat healthily. You would eat vegetables, fruits, and a bit of protein here and there. You wouldn’t be having drinks, ice cream, etc. A lot of the things you like and want, you have to cut out for the time that you are slimming down and getting to your right size. It’s the same way in your business.

You really have to cut out some of the things you might like and want. At this point in time, you’re on a business diet, so you don’t have that luxury anymore.

You can only get that luxury back when your business has those extra sales, when you come up with methodology to increase those sales. Then you can increase the luxuries again, but I wouldn’t do that.

Let me cover one more point about investing, if you don’t mind. If you’re looking at investments right now, be careful of only going for asset appreciation. I was talking about this before. You don’t know if things are going to appreciate.

What we’re looking for right now is cash flow. Many times you have both cash flow and appreciation. In the worst-case scenario, you want to have cash flow in economic times like this. If you’re going to buy a stock, look at stocks that have excellent dividends.

If you’re going to get involved in real estate, maybe you decide to invest in more of a commercial real estate that has a positive cash flow. Maybe you’re buying a part of a plaza or a little retail mall, or something like that, that has strong AAA tenants who are serving with necessities.

What you’re buying is cash flow. You’re not worrying about whether it goes up or down. You don’t care about that because you’re not selling the thing.

Here’s an example. I’m involved in some commercial real estate. I invest. Some of them I buy on my own. Some of them I buy with managed groups so I don’t have to put up as much money. You can actually put up a very small amount and get involved with that. I get a check for positive cash flow every month.

I’m not selling it, so I don’t care if it’s appreciating $1 million or $5 million or if it’s going down $1 million. I don’t care. I just get my same check every month. They still pay their rent. Their rent is the same every month. In fact, it’s going to go up in about a year. I’m just looking for cash flow.

One of the key things in investing right now is if you have things on sale, then appreciation is fine. But if you buy things for cash flow, you’re going to be jelling right there. One more thing we were talking about is this idea of the kind of businesses. There are two elements. First, if you sell to high net-worth individuals, such as multimillionaires and millionaires, and you have an expensive product, you’ll probably do okay.

Most people I know who are high net worth aren’t going to be overly affected by this whole thing. They’re the ones who are buying up the stuff that everybody else is selling.

Right now, I’m trying to sell things just to get into cash in order to buy other stuff. My philosophy, however, in this type of economics is that you want to be looking toward the best as possible, either serving the higher-end market, because they’re not as affected, or being able to offer needs versus wants.

You have to compete with the disposable income. If the disposable income is less and people have less confidence, they’re going to tighten their belt and, like you, buy needs. The question is what is a need?

They are the things that are a necessity. People still have to eat, but they may not go out to a fancy restaurant like they used to every Saturday night. They might go once every two or three weeks now. People still have to wear clothes and shoes, but they may not be buying 40 pairs of shoes. The more needs you can get, the better.
